Fee structure
The University of North Carolina Board of Governors has delegated to the UNC System Office the authority to set application and renewal fees for non-public and out-of-state institutions to conduct degree-granting postsecondary activity. Until superseded, the fee structure adopted in October 2006 remains in effect. Therefore, application and yearly renewal fees are as follows:
Application Fees
Application fee for an institution’s first application for licensure: $5,000
For institutions applying to offer academic programs in North Carolina, this fee includes up to four degree programs at the associate or bachelor’s levels, two degree programs at the master’s level, or one degree program at the doctoral level. Institutions whose first application for licensure includes degree programs beyond those limits will pay the additional application fees listed below.
Application fees for institutions adding academic programs after initial licensure or whose first application for licensure contains additional programs:
| Degree Level | Fee |
|---|---|
| Associate’s degree | $1,000 |
| Bachelor’s degree | $1,500 |
| Master’s degree | $2,000 |
| Doctoral/Professional degree | $3,000 |
| Other postsecondary credit-bearing credential | $500 |
Please be advised that a 10% administrative fee is assessed on all invoices issued for new applications and annual fees.
Annual Fees
If an institution has been issued a regular license or an interim permit to offer academic programs in North Carolina, its annual fees are as follows:
| Number of Programs | Fee |
|---|---|
| 1-5 programs | $4,000 |
| 6-10 programs | $6,000 |
| 11-15 programs | $8,000 |
| 16-20 programs | $10,000 |
| 21-25 programs | $12,000 |
| 26-30 programs | $14,000 |
| Over 30 programs | $16,000 |
If an institution is licensed only to operate an administrative campus in North Carolina, its annual fees are:
| Number of Programs | Fee |
|---|---|
| Up to 1000 North Carolina residents enrolled | $5,000 |
| More than 1000 North Carolina residents enrolled | $10,000 |
When an institution has a campus and additional learning sites or annexes within North Carolina, that institution will be assessed an additional $1,000 annual fee for each such site.
Annual fees are due at the time the institution files its annual report. Assess annual fees for regular licenses and interim permits based upon the maximum number of programs the institution offers or has offered in North Carolina in the current academic year.
